In Season 2, Episode 8 of "Buying Alaska," viewers meet three couples eager to make a move to the Great Frontier and realize their dreams of living in the wild. The episode titled "Fish Out of Water" presents an exciting journey that takes us to some of the most breathtaking locations in Alaska.
The episode begins by introducing viewers to the three couples, each with their unique tastes and needs. The first couple, Jim and Georgia, is from Arizona and ready to escape the heat. They're looking for a picturesque log cabin near a lake where they can spend their time fishing, kayaking, and enjoying the outdoors. They're looking for a home with enough room to host their family, but not so vast that they'll be overwhelmed with maintenance.
The second couple, Brian and Martina, is from Virginia and ready to start a new chapter in their lives. They dream of living off the grid and sustaining themselves through hunting and fishing. They're hoping to find a remote and off-grid property, one that will provide them with the opportunity to create a self-sufficient lifestyle.
Finally, viewers get to meet Christian and Ashla from Canada. They're ready to move to Alaska to be closer to Ashla's family. The couple is looking for a family home that offers plenty of space for their young family, as well as opportunities to enjoy the outdoors.
As the episode progresses, viewers are taken on a tour of various properties that could fit each couple's unique needs and style. The properties range from modest cabins to grand homes, but all have one thing in common: They're situated in some of the most picturesque locations in Alaska.
For the first couple, Jim and Georgia, the realtor shows them a beautiful three-bedroom log cabin with soaring ceilings and an expansive deck that overlooks a lake. The property also has a wood stove and modern amenities that Jim and Georgia are looking for, such as a modern kitchen and a large living area.
However, the challenges of owning a home in such a remote location soon become apparent. The couple is concerned about access to emergency services and the impact of harsh winter weather on their home. Despite the challenges, Jim and Georgia are smitten with the cabin and decide to make an offer.
The second couple, Brian and Martina, hope to live more self-sufficiently. The realtor shows them a property with a stunning view of Kachemak Bay and the Kenai Mountains. This property is a completely off-grid home, powered by solar and wind energy. The couple is thrilled to see such a self-sufficient home, and they're excited by the opportunities for hunting and fishing in the local area.
Christian and Ashla are looking for a family home that offers enough space for their young family. The realtor takes them to a large home with mountain views. The property has a large yard, a wraparound deck, and plenty of storage space. Christian and Ashla appreciate the home's spaciousness but want to ensure there's enough room to expand their family. They decide to keep looking.
